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40728 68 90068534726
17 0468970 161
17 0468970 161
32497860992 546 21543
All about undefined
Interested in learning more?
17 0468970 161
32497860992 546 21543
See more
9621299398 79
92 60 393 0485 7661096998
See more
7282 57839716525 907410
0177488789 710375844 805 80900169750
See more